A leading early years education provider in Tring is seeking a Nursery Nurse to join their friendly team. This role emphasizes supporting children's development in a fun and creative environment. The ideal candidate should be passionate about early years education and enjoy being part of a nurturing team. This full-time position offers a salary ranging from £12.50-£13.20 per hour along with various benefits to ensure a rewarding work experience.

How to prepare for a job interview at Kindred Nurseries
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, brush up on early years education principles and practices. Familiarise yourself with the latest trends in child development and creative play techniques. This will show your passion for the role and help you engage in meaningful conversations.
✨Show Your Personality
Being a Nursery Nurse is all about connecting with children and their families. During the interview, let your personality shine through! Share anecdotes that highlight your nurturing nature and creativity in engaging with kids. This will help the interviewers see how you'd fit into their friendly team.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some questions that reflect your interest in the nursery's approach to education. Ask about their methods for supporting children's development or how they encourage creative play.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the environment aligns with your values.
✨Dress for Success
While the role is in a fun and creative environment, it's still important to present yourself professionally. Opt for smart-casual attire that reflects your personality but also shows you take the interview seriously. A good first impression can go a long way!
